


Dominique Strauss-Kahn will remain in prison until the grand jury hearing which will determine next Friday (May 20) whether to hold a criminal trial for attempted rape against a maid at the Sofitel in New York.
Meanwhile, several journalists and observers theorize the plot, while others seek ways to meet in person the mysterious woman who is accusing Strauss-Khan.
